  • La-Proteina introduces a novel partially latent protein representation for atomistic protein design, combining explicit coarse backbone structure with per-residue latent variables for sequence and atomistic details.
  • The model achieves state-of-the-art performance in all-atom co-designability, diversity, structural validity, and atomistic motif scaffolding, outperforming previous models.
  • La-Proteina can generate co-designable proteins up to 800 residues, demonstrating scalability and robustness where most baselines fail.
  • The framework includes an autoencoder and latent diffusion model, with specific checkpoints provided for different tasks and protein lengths.
